Estructuras de control

9
Estructuras de Control JAVA JESUS MARTINEZ FAJARDO

Transcript of Estructuras de control

Page 1: Estructuras de control

Estructuras de Control

JAVA

JESUS MARTINEZ FAJARDO

Page 2: Estructuras de control

Estructuras de control if else.

La instrucción condicional if … else es una estructura de selección doble, ya que selecciona entre dos acciones distintas y es utilizado cuando desea ejecutar diferentes partes del código con base en una simple prueba.

Page 3: Estructuras de control

ESTRUCTURA

If (Condición) {

Instrucciones }

Else {

Otras instrucciones }

Page 4: Estructuras de control

Ejemplo

Dada X EDAD indicar si es mayor o menor de edad.

1.- Declarar la clase

2.- Utilizar Scanner lector=new Scanner(System.in): Es una clase que hereda de la clase Object  e implementa la interface , que nos permite la lectura de datos desde distintas fuentes como la entrada estándar de datos.

La utilización de la clase Scanner es muy sencilla. Lo primero que tenemos que hacer es declarar un objeto Scanner.

Page 5: Estructuras de control

3.- Declarar variables.

4.-Pedir la edadSystem.out.println("Introduce la edad");

5.-Leer la edad edad=lector.nextLine();

6.-Pase de parámetros, es decir convertir una cadena a un entero

eda=Integer.parseInt(edad);

Page 6: Estructuras de control

7.- Se establece la condición

if (eda>=18) System.out.println("Mayor de

edad"); else System.out.println("Menor de

edad");

Page 7: Estructuras de control

Ejemplo

public class Edad { public static void main(String[] args) { Scanner lector=new Scanner(System.in); String edad; int eda; System.out.println("Introduce la edad"); edad=lector.nextLine(); eda=Integer.parseInt(edad);

if (eda>=18) System.out.println("Mayor de edad"); else System.out.println("Menor de edad"); }}

Page 8: Estructuras de control

Operadores Aritméticos

OPERADOR DESCRIPCIÓN

+ Suma

- Resta

* Multiplicación

/ División

% Módulo

Page 9: Estructuras de control

Operadores Relacionales

OPERADOR DESCRIPCION

> Mayor que

< Menor que

>= Mayor igual

<= Menor igual

!= Diferente

== Igual